    Looking at the long list of M11x owners with hinge issues, I figured it was only fair to make a list of owners that haven't had any issues with their hinges.

    Owners without hinge issues, post when your M11x was built and any notes you can regarding your hinges and usage (leaving it on a desk, carrying it everywhere, etc). The thread with owners that have had hinge issues is a little unsettling for new and potential owners, so let's see who hasn't had any problems with their M11x and figure out whether having hinge issues puts you in the minority or the majority of active Notebook Review users.

    Most People w/o hinge issues will not post because they are not motivated, don't get me wrong a few might care and post but the majority of people that are only motivated are the ones with hinge issues since they want this resolve. Real Talk
